u/belabacsijolvan 2d ago
its meh at a first glance.
the 61 vs 77 experiment numbers are not a good sign. as the experiment is easily repeatable there is no other reason for the difference than p-hacking or laziness.
although they seemingly controlled for time and location, they used different pregnant woman in the control group, which is a pretty big factor to not control for imo.tbh for a random experimental social psychology paper the sample size and the speculation in the discussion is quite ok.
overall its a fun little paper, not terrible. id guess the effect exists but its not reproducible within error. but you know, most experimental social psychology papers arent so meh.

I scrolled to the conclusion of the study and this is their exact conclusion: âIn conclusion, this study suggests that unexpected events can increase prosocial behavior by momentarily disrupting automatic attention patterns and fostering situational awareness. These findings open new avenues for understanding the environmental and cognitive mechanisms underlying prosociality, and suggest potential applications for promoting kindness and cooperation in everyday settingsâextending the âBatman effectâ to non-superheroes as wellâ
